In the first quarter of 2025, the top Match 3 games in Germany showcased varied performance across downloads, revenue, and active user trends. Here's a closer look at each game's performance, based on data from Sensor Tower.
Royal Match by Dream Games experienced a gradual decline in weekly downloads, starting at 41K and settling at around 30K by the end of March. Revenue saw fluctuations, peaking at approximately $1.8M at the start of the quarter and stabilizing near $1.5M. Active users remained relatively stable, averaging around 1.4M, with a slight increase towards the end of March.
Gardenscapes from Playrix showed a notable decline in downloads from 37K to about 17K throughout the quarter. Revenue peaked at $1.03M in early March but ended the quarter at approximately $722K. Active users fluctuated, peaking at 1.3M and closing the quarter at around 1.1M.
Candy Crush Saga by King maintained relatively stable download numbers, averaging 22K weekly, with a slight dip to 16K by the end of March. Revenue varied, peaking at $1M in late March, while active users remained steady around 1.2M.
Gossip Harbor®: Merge & Story from Microfun Limited saw a decrease in downloads from 53K to 15K over the quarter. Revenue peaked at $601K mid-March and settled at $485K. Active users began at 247K and remained fairly consistent, ending at 249K.
Fishdom also by Playrix, experienced a decline in downloads from 22K to 7K by the end of March. Revenue peaked at $593K in late January, tapering down to $417K. Active users showed a slight increase, closing the quarter at 1.16M.
